Start with the basics. Refuse, reduce, reuse
The first steps in adopting a zero-waste lifestyle involve the three Rs: refuse, reduce, and reuse. Begin by declining products that you don’t need, especially those with excessive packaging. Next, lessen the amount of waste you produce by choosing higher-quality items that last longer. Finally, repurpose items instead of discarding them. By incorporating these practices, you’ll not only cut down on waste but also become more mindful of your consumption habits.

Recycling beyond the blue bin with TerraCycle
While traditional recycling programs are limited to commonly recycled materials like paper, glass, and certain plastics, the brand takes it a step further. They specialize in diverting items from landfills that typical programs won’t accept, such as toothpaste tubes, snack wrappers, and even cigarette butts. By participating in its free recycling programs, sponsored by brands looking to make a difference, you can ensure that almost every bit of your waste is processed responsibly.

Leveraging TerraCycle’s zero-waste boxes
These boxes can be filled with various types of waste, depending on the specific box you choose. Once full, they are returned to TerraCycle for processing. This service is particularly useful for offices or parties where waste is inevitable but can still be managed sustainably.
